std::is_member_object_pointer - cppreference.com (original) (raw)

| | | | | -------------------------------------------------------- | | ------------- | | template< class T > struct is_member_object_pointer; | | (since C++11) |

std::is_member_object_pointer is a UnaryTypeTrait.

Checks whether T is a non-static member object pointer. Provides the member constant value which is equal to true, if T is a non-static member object pointer type. Otherwise, value is equal to false.

If the program adds specializations for std::is_member_object_pointer or std::is_member_object_pointer_v, the behavior is undefined.

[edit] Helper variable template

| template< class T > constexpr bool is_member_object_pointer_v = is_member_object_pointer<T>::value; | | (since C++17) | | ------------------------------------------------------------------------------------------------------------- | | ------------- |
